I suggest clean reinstall:

1. Close Spotify and uninstall it.
2. Go to %AppData% in Windows Explorer, and delete any Spotify folders you find in Local and Roaming folders.
3. Restart your computer.
4. Install Spotify.

 

If you're running the Windows Store app, you'll need to uninstall it from Apps & Features. Check here for extra information.

It might be that some error happened in program files causing this issue.

 

I also just remembered Windows 10 installed updates recently and one of them caused audio driver issues (Spotify stopped playing). The solution in this case is reinstalling the audio driver.
